Output deb2a196ebfda78f56559b68dc265479a3717b0184f596c276618f7722d9de41:5

value
2036437
script pubkey
OP_0 OP_PUSHBYTES_20 17f4042c77ad22c0a113309a9e4d09fd81fd983a
address
bc1qzl6qgtrh453vpggnxzdfungflkqlmxp6ymaa5s
transaction
deb2a196ebfda78f56559b68dc265479a3717b0184f596c276618f7722d9de41